bzr too slow

Robert Collins robertc at robertcollins.net
Wed Jan 11 04:14:05 GMT 2006


On Tue, 2006-01-10 at 22:04 -0600, John A Meinel wrote:
> Martin Pool wrote:
> > On 10 Jan 2006, Denys Duchier <duchier at ps.uni-sb.de> wrote:
> >> John Arbash Meinel <john at arbash-meinel.com> writes:
> >>
> >>> Are you actually seeing the file getting written out repeatedly? If so,
> >>> I'll +1 a patch.
> >> I have a patch available as revision 1516 in the branch at:
> >>
> >>            http://delta.univ-orleans.fr/~duchier/bzr/bzr.call_at_end
> > 
> > Thankyou.
> > 
> > The updated patch is as attached.  +1 from me, except that it would be
> > nice to have some tests - at least a test that callbacks are run at the
> > close of a transaction and only at the end.
> > 
> 
> Nothing was attached, so I'm not sure what you changed.
> 
> I think the concept of having transactions run actions at the end is
> nice. I think Robert also had a valid idea of just checking the lock. I
> just didn't know if we wanted to use a hidden branch object. But if we
> are going to be splitting out a new lock for working tree anyway...

Yeah, I forgot to add a -1: I'm very much against early-generalisation,
and I think this is a case of that. My suggestion to use a non supported
attribute of branch is purely for migration until we have checkout/
done.

Rob

-- 
GPG key available at: <http://www.robertcollins.net/keys.txt>.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: This is a digitally signed message part
Url : https://lists.ubuntu.com/archives/bazaar/attachments/20060111/f429b7dd/attachment.pgp 


More information about the bazaar mailing list